Intermediate Jar Typical of the period with elongated body and a flat base.

This type of vessel was made before the invention of the wheel made ancient pottery 2300 – 2000 BC.

This type of pottery was used for storage dry material such as dates and other seeds.

The rim is shaped as a v shape in order to close it easily with a leather and ties it from the neck.

The intermediate bronze age period is a unique time between the early bronze age (the time of establishment of cities) and the Middle bronze age the time of Patriarchs.
